FAQS on types of fire hose rolling

Q: What are the common types of fire hose rolling techniques?

A: Common techniques include the Double Donut Roll, Single Roll, and Horseshoe Roll. Each method suits specific storage or deployment needs. The choice depends on hose size, storage space, and accessibility requirements.

Q: How does the Horseshoe Roll differ from the Double Donut Roll?

A: The Horseshoe Roll folds the hose into a U-shape for quick deployment, ideal for attack lines. The Double Donut Roll creates two circular loops, optimizing compact storage. The former prioritizes speed, while the latter focuses on space efficiency.

Q: Why are there different types of fire hose rolling methods?

A: Different methods address varying operational needs, such as rapid deployment, storage efficiency, or minimizing kinks. For example, a Straight Roll simplifies drying, while a Triple Layer Roll suits large-diameter hoses. Method selection impacts performance and longevity.

Q: Which fire hose rolling type is best for storage in tight compartments?

A: The Double Donut Roll or Accordion Roll works best for tight spaces due to their compact shape. These rolls minimize bulk while keeping the hose organized. Avoid bulky methods like the Straight Roll for limited storage areas.

Q: Can improper fire hose rolling damage the hose?

A: Yes, incorrect rolling (e.g., uneven folds or excessive twists) can cause kinks, cracks, or liner damage. Always follow manufacturer guidelines for rolling types like the Single Roll or Horseshoe Roll. Proper technique extends hose lifespan and ensures reliability.
